    Just a querie if anyone wants to help out. Just wondering why all other apps work with the exploit except for Naplink? I am using the MCBOOT coded by JUM and it is the only app that doesnt want to boot? I am running all this in a V9 Euro machine.

    I am booting with my original psx game, it takes me to the menu where i select Naplink.ELF app from the Memory Card, and then no go!!!!! I know JUM's readme said Naplink requires the CD, so I placed the Naplink CD in before executing the ELF file and still no go!

    I know my naplink CD works, as I have a modded V7 and it boots fine from that!

    Any suggestions would be great

    Hello

    The problem is that naplink need 2 files in IRX Format, and these files can't be read by the memory card, it need the cd with IRX files of Naplink. Maybe it'll work one day for non-modded Ps2, be patient...

    Naplink w/exploit= black screen also with all nedeed files in memcard . The executable will search files on CD ( cdrom0 ).
    Need a modified vers. of the exec to run from MC.

    yeah its simple just replace the cdrom0:\%filename;1 calls with those appropriate with your BXDATA dir on your memory card.
